Crews Battle Fire Behind Lakewood Strip Mall

A large fire behind a Lakewood shopping complex may have been caused by fireworks, West Metro Fire Rescue said.

Fire crews battled a half-acre blaze behind a strip mall in Lakewood Tuesday, fire officials said.

LAKEWOOD, CO — Fire crews were called to a grass fire behind the Foothills Shopping Center in Lakewood early Tuesday afternoon.

The fire spread to half-an-acre near the 13100 block of West Alameda, according to West Metro Fire Rescue.

A loud boom was heard in the area and witnesses saw a young person running from the field, fire officials said.

West Metro Fire Rescue officials warned that there is currently a high fire danger in their district.

An investigation was underway. No further details were released.
